The Couch Critic
Couch Critic
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Movies
TV Shows
Trending
Top Reviewed
What to Watch
Vishnu Rajan | The Couch Critic
Born
November 1, 1991
Place of Birth
Trivandrum, Kerala, India
Known For
Production
Vishnu Rajan
Movies
TV Shows
As Director
OH GOD !
Movie
as TOM
January 20, 2025